The hotel is located on Golovinskoe Avenue in the north of Moscow by the metro station Vodny Stadion. This cosy and modern business hotel is ideal for tourists and business travellers. Built in 1980 and completely renovated in 2008 to meet European standards of quality and design, the hotel consists of a total of 104 rooms. Guests are welcomed into a lobby with a 24-hour reception service. Facilities include a hotel safe, currency exchange facilities and a bar-restaurant open during the day. It offers free Wi-Fi and features air-conditioned rooms. The rooms come equipped with cable TV, a work desk and minibar. The private bathrooms have hairdryers. At the hotel's restaurant guests can enjoy classical music while having breakfast or lunch.